    INTRODUCTION

    Eat-shrink tubing, also known as heat shrink or heatshrink, is a plastic tube that can be shrunk and is used to shield stranded and solid wire conductors from abrasion and the environment to protect connectors, joints, and terminals in electrical wiring.

     

    It can also be used to make bundles of wires, fix the insulation on wires, protect wires or small parts from light abrasion, and make cable entry seals that give environmental sealing protection.

     

    Heat-shrink tubing, which is often constructed of polyolefin, shrinks radially when heated (but not longitudinally), to a diameter of half to one-sixth of its original size.

    NEW PRODUCT LAUNCH

    FEP QuickShrink 2.0, the company’s new generation of FEP heat shrink tubing, is released by Optinova. The quick shrinking method used by the FEP QuickShrink 2.0 results in a shorter production cycle and cheaper manufacturing costs.

     

    The excellent anti-stick surface, high transparency, chemical resistance, and high lubricity make it the perfect material for forming, reflow processing, and tube bonding. Between 176°F and 338°F, FEP QuickShrink 2.0’s low and adjustable shrink temperature ranges from 80°C to 170°C. High quality and consistency from batch to batch have helped Optinova gain notoriety in the medical tubing industry.

     

    Customers of FEP HS can count on the parts to function consistently between batches.

     

    Both custom solutions and pre-made stock in carefully chosen dimensions are offered for FEP QuickShrink 2.0. Features and advantages of FEP QuickShrink 2.0’s quick shrinking method Product design that saves money Reduced temperature for shrinking excellent chemical resistance and minimal gas permeability UV rays are transmitted quite well.

     

    outstanding electrical insulating values ETO, gamma, e-beam, and autoclave. Sterilisable.Electrical applications frequently make use of heat shrink tubing.

     

    This tubing helps prevent shorts and failures by aiding in the insulation and binding of loose wires, wire splices, and strain relief. It also provides strain relief.

     

    Shrink tubing is frequently employed in straightforward projects and on assembly lines to organise wires, cables, and tubes according to colour for simpler identification.
